Questions about Fats
What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Fats is a mixed breed dog who generally adapts well to various living environments, including homes with small yards or even apartments, as long as she gets regular exercise. A balanced lifestyle with both activity and indoor relaxation suits her best.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
While Fats will benefit from access to a secure yard, she is also perfectly content with daily walks and regular outings. Mixed breed dogs like her appreciate structured playtime outdoors but don’t need a massive yard as long as their exercise needs are met.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Mixed breed dogs like Fats are often friendly and adaptable, frequently making good companions for families with children. As with all dogs, supervised introductions and respectful interactions are essential.
